Join with us to make this Pumpkin Walk (Drive thru) bigger and better than ever before! We are hosting the event on the Saturday before Halloween (October 30th). However this year we are switching things up a bit, the how, where, when and why of the actual pumpkin carving, for a number of reasons; 1- Children that are being homeschooled will be able to take part... 2- Children & families that do not attend BES will be able to take part 3- Opening the pumpkin carving up to everyone 4- Ease of organizing with less volunteer requirements. 5- Less risk for people in the school that have pumpkin allergies Pumpkins will not be carved at the school, pumpkins will be available for pickup and drop off at the Barrhead Regional Aquatic Centre, for approximately a week before the pumpkin walk, and families will simply have to stop in during business hours, pick up a pumpkin to take home and carve and bring it back for display. Please keep in mind that there are a limited number of pumpkins available. Pick up & drop off will be at the Barrhead Regional Aquatic Centre (Front Desk) at the following times: Mon, October 25th- 12:00 pm 8:00 pm Tues 26, Wed 27, Thu 28, - 8:00 am 8:00 pm Friday 29 8:00 am 12:00 pm On the day of the event pumpkins will be placed on the path and volunteers will select approx. 10 pumpkins to enter into the Pumpkin Contest, Judges will be assembled and winners announced before fireworks. As this year’s event will be in a drive thru format, you will enter the drive thru pumpkin path at the agrena entrance by the bowling alley, forming a line down the service road and rodeo drive, there will be traffic control to assist with directions. Please follow signage, drive slowly with extreme caution and remain in your vehicles at all times, there will be no foot traffic, roller blades/skates, bicycles, skateboards, scooters etc, allowed to enter. The event will start at 5:00 and run until a 7:30 firework display. Admission to the event from the public will be a donation to the food bank we will have a box on site for collection. An air horn will blast to start at 5:00 and a warning blast will go off 15 min before fireworks. Booths will be closed at 7:30PM.
